H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ptus, pievienojiet vietnes un viegli pārvaldiet VPS

Vai vēlaties viegli pārvaldīt savu virtuālo privāto serveri (VPS)? Uzziniet, kā instalētHestiaCPPanelis izcilai servera pārvaldības pieredzei.

mūsuVisumsPirmā līmeņa rokasgrāmata palīdzēs jums soli pa solim pabeigt HestiaCP instalēšanu un konfigurēšanu, aptverot instalēšanas skriptus, vietņu papildinājumus un ugunsmūrus, padarot jūsu servera pārvaldību efektīvu un drošu.

Ko nozīmē Hestia?

Hestija ir krāsns dieviete sengrieķu mitoloģijā.

Kad mēs runājam par Hestiju, lielākā daļa cilvēku vispirms domā par pavarda, krāsns un uguns dievieti sengrieķu mitoloģijā. Viņa ir viens no divpadsmit galvenajiem Olimpa dieviem.

Hestia, kas pazīstama ar savu siltumu un aizsardzību, nodrošina, ka māju un tempļu liesmas nekad neizdziest.

Līdzīgi mūsdienu datoru pasaulē Hestia arī spēlē nozīmīgu lomu - HestiaCP.

H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ptus, pievienojiet vietnes un viegli pārvaldiet VPS

HestiaCP panelis viegli pārvalda VPS

HestiaCP ir atvērtā koda avots Linux Servera vadības paneļa artefakts.

  • HestiaCP var saukt par serveru pārvaldības "vispusīgo".
  • HestiaCP ir pazīstama ar savu vienkāršību, efektivitāti un daudzpusību.
  • Tāpat kā šī senā dieviete, nodrošinot uzticamu aizsardzību un atbalstu jūsu serverim.

Tas ir dzimis no populārā VestaCP, taču, VestaCP izstrādei un uzturēšanai pamazām ieejot "miega režīmā", daudzas drošības problēmas un ievainojamības netika laikus novērstas...

Rezultātā grupa tālredzīgu izstrādātāju nolēma sākt no jauna un izveidoja jaunu filiāli Hestia CP, lai turpinātu tās pilnveidošanu un uzturēšanu, lai padarītu servera pārvaldību drošāku un ērtāku.

HestiaCP vadības paneļa funkcijas ieviešana

HestiaCP nodrošina vienkāršu un ērti lietojamu saskarni, jūs varat viegli pievienot lietotāju kontus, vietņu domēnu nosaukumus un konfigurēt citus servera aspektus.

Šeit ir dažas galvenās funkcijas:

  • Vairāku valodu atbalsts: HestiaCP atbalsta vairākas valodas, tostarp ķīniešu valodu.
  • Tīmekļa servera atbalsts: Apache2 un NGINX ar PHP-FPM, atbalsta vairākas PHP versijas (5.6-8.1, noklusējuma 8.0).
  • DNS serveris: DNS serveris (Bind) ar klastera funkciju.
  • Pasta pakalpojums: nodrošina POP/IMAP/SMTP pasta pakalpojumu ar pretvīrusu, pretsurogātpasta un tīmekļa pastu (ClamAV, SpamAssassin, Sieve, Roundcube, Rainloop).
  • Datu bāze: atbalsta MariaDB un/vai PostgreSQL datu bāzes.
  • SSL atbalsts: atbalsta Let's Encrypt SSL un aizstājējzīmju sertifikātus.
  • Ugunsmūris: ugunsmūris ar brutālā spēka uzbrukumu noteikšanu un IP sarakstiem (iptables, fail2ban un ipset).

H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ptu, pievienojiet vietni un viegli pārvaldiet VPS attēlu 2

Pamatprasības HestiaCP instalēšanai

Pirms Hestia instalēšanas jums ir jāsaprot tās pamatprasības serverim.

Lai nodrošinātu tās pareizu darbību, Hestia ir jādarbojas ar pavisam jaunu operētājsistēmu.

Tālāk ir norādītas minimālās un ieteicamās konfigurācijas.

Konfigurācijas veidsProcesorsAtmiņadisks操作系统
Minimālā konfigurācija1 kodols, 64 bitu1 GB (bez SpamAssassin un ClamAV)10 GB cietais disksDebian 10, 11 vai 12, Ubuntu 20.04, 22.04 LTS
Ieteicamā konfigurācija4 Kodolenerģija4 GB40 GB cietvielu disksJaunākais Debian, jaunākais Ubuntu LTS

citas prasības

  • Hestia darbojas tikai AMD64/x86_64 un ARM64/aarch64 procesoros, un tai ir nepieciešama 64 bitu operētājsistēma.
  • i386 vai ARM7 procesori netiek atbalstīti.
  • Operētājsistēmas, kas nav LTS, netiek atbalstītas.

HestiaCP paneļu uzstādīšanas sagatavošana

1. darbība: pārslēdzieties uz root lietotāju

Pirmkārt, jums ir jāpalaiž instalētājs kā root. To var palaist tieši terminālī vai attālināti, izmantojot SSH.

Palaidiet šo komandu, lai pārslēgtos uz root lietotāju:

sudo -i

2. darbība: jauniniet sistēmas pakotnes

Pirms instalēšanas sākuma pārliecinieties, vai sistēmas pakotnes ir atjauninātas. Lai jauninātu, palaidiet šo komandu:

apt update -y

3. darbība. Instalējiet kopējo软件

Debian sistēma ir salīdzinoši tīra. Ieteicams instalēt kādu bieži lietotu programmatūru.

apt install wget curl sudo vim git -y

4. darbība: pievienojiet DNS ierakstus

Vispārīgi runājot, DNS ir jāpievieno A ieraksts, lai IP adresi atrisinātu kā HestiaCP resursdatora domēna nosaukumu, piemēram:

H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ptu, pievienojiet vietni un viegli pārvaldiet VPS attēlu 3

hcp.domain.tld

(Aizstāt domēna.tld ar savu faktisko domēna nosaukumu)

HestiaCP instalēšanas skripta apmācība

1. darbība: lejupielādējiet instalācijas skriptu

Lejupielādējiet instalācijas skriptu, izmantojot SSH, izmantojot šo komandu:

wget https://raw.githubusercontent.com/hestiacp/hestiacp/release/install/hst-install.sh

Ja lejupielāde neizdodas SSL verifikācijas kļūdas dēļ, pārliecinieties, vai jūsu sistēmā ir instalēta ca-certificate pakotne.

To var izdarīt, izmantojot šādu komandu:

apt-get update && apt-get install ca-certificates -y

2. darbība. Palaidiet HestiaCP instalācijas skriptu

Vienkāršāks veids, kā atlasīt HestiaCP instalēšanas opcijas, ir izmantot instalācijas virknes ģeneratoru.

Lai izvēlētos, kuru programmatūru instalēt, varat izvēlēties izmantot HestiaCP instalācijas virknes ģeneratoru, lai izvēlētos, kuru programmatūru instalēt.

Noklikšķiniet uz tālāk esošās saites, lai pārietu uz HestiaCP oficiālajiem pielāgotajiem parametriem un konfigurācijas opcijām:

Izvēlieties pēc vajadzības:

HestiaCP pievieno vietnes domēna nosaukumu Nr.4

Šeit ir komandas piemērs:

bash hst-install.sh --lang zh-cn --hostname hcp.domain.tld --email [email protected] --password p4ssw0rd --multiphp yes --sieve yes --quota yes --force

Ja jums tas šķiet apgrūtinoši, varat arī izmantotČens VeiliangsTomēr atcerieties tohcp.domain.tld,[email protected],p4ssw0rd , mainiet to uz to, ko jūs faktiski izmantojat.

3. darbība: restartējiet serveri

Kad instalēšana ir pabeigta, ievadiet servera restartēšanas komandu:

reboot

HestiaCP panelis konfigurē SSL sertifikātu

第 1 步:Pievienojiet SSL sertifikātu paneļa URL:

v-add-letsencrypt-host

Ja saimniekdatora nosaukums iepriekš nav iestatīts, vispirms tas jāpalaiž:

v-change-sys-hostname hcp.domain.tld

Mainiet hcp.domain.tl uz savu resursdatora nosaukumu.

第 2 步:Pēc tam ievadiet pārlūkprogrammā https://hcp.domain.tld:2053

Jūs varat piekļūt panelim.

Konta paroli var redzēt komandrindā.

HestiaCP panelis pievieno vietni

Tā kā noklusējuma root lietotājs nav drošs, ja vēlaties HestiaCP panelim pievienot vietni, ieteicams izveidot jaunu lietotāju un pieteikties jaunajā lietotāja kontā, lai pievienotu vietnes domēna nosaukumu.

1. darbība:Pievienot lietotāja kontu▼

H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ptu, pievienojiet vietni un viegli pārvaldiet VPS attēlu 5

第 2 步:Pievienojiet vietnes domēna nosaukumu ▼

HestiaCP paneļa visuma līmeņa apmācība: instalējiet skriptu, pievienojiet vietni un viegli pārvaldiet VPS attēlu 6

  • Nav ieteicams pārbaudīt DNS atbalstu un pastkastes atbalstu, jo paša izveidotā DNS un pastkaste nav pietiekami stabila, kā arī ir viegli palaist garām svarīgus e-pastus.
  • Tāpēc tas būs stabilāks, ja izmantosim lielāko ražotāju DNS un pastkastes.

第 3 步:Rediģēt vietnes domēna nosaukumu ▼

3. darbība. Rediģējiet vietnes domēna nosaukumu. Ieteicams atzīmēt izvēles rūtiņu “Iespējot SSL šim domēnam”.

Ieteicams pārbaudīt:Iespējot SSL šim domēnam

  • Iegūstiet SSL sertifikātu, izmantojot funkciju Let's Encrypt
  • Iespējot HTTPS automātisko novirzīšanu
  • Iespējot HTTP stingru transporta drošību (HSTS)

Kā jaudīgs un elastīgs servera pārvaldības panelis HestiaCP nodrošina ne tikai bagātīgas funkcijas un efektīvus pārvaldības rīkus, bet arī nodrošina lietošanas ērtumu un mērogojamību.

Neatkarīgi no tā, vai pārvaldāt personīgo serveri vai uzņēmuma līmeņa serveri, HestiaCP var apmierināt jūsu vajadzības, ļaujot jums viegli kontrolēt uguni un drošību kā dieviete Hestia.

Lai uzzinātu vairāk par HestiaCP, lūdzu, apmeklējiet tā GitHub projekta adresi un oficiālās vietnes adresi.

Izbaudiet HestiaCP jaudīgās funkcijas un izbaudiet vienkāršu un efektīvu servera pārvaldību!

Vai vēlaties uzzināt vairāk par HestiaCP?

Ieteicams turpināt lasīt mūsu detalizēto rokasgrāmatu par to, kā atrisināt HestiaCP phpMyAdmin - Kļūdas problēma.

Šis ir vienreizējais risinājums, kas palīdzēs jums viegli tikt galā ar izplatītām kļūdām▼

Noklikšķiniet uz tālāk esošās saites, un jūs atradīsit detalizētākus risinājumus, lai atrisinātu lēna ātruma problēmu, ko izraisa HestiaCP phpMyAdmin nespēja saglabāt veidņu kešatmiņu ▼

Kā HestiaCP iespējo PHP funkcijas shell_exec, passthr, system un exec?

Vai HestiaCP PHP-FPM ir liela slodze? Dinamiskās tīmekļa lapas 500 kļūda? Šī optimizācija stāsies spēkā nekavējoties!

发表 评论

Jūsu e-pasta adrese netiks publicēta. 必填 项 已 用 * Etiķete

Ritiniet uz augšu